Personal Knowledge Tools That Found Audiences\n\n### 1.1 Roam Research: The Cult That Grew Itself\n\nRoam Research launched in late 2019 with a deliberately exclusive positioning — no free tier, $15/month or $500/year, and early access only to vetted researchers. Founder Conor White-Sullivan targeted \"high expectation customers who knew that their personal knowledge management system was completely inefficient, working with researchers from the AI community who were ready to pay from day one\" ([The Hustle](https://thehustle.co/09142020-roam-research)).\n\nThe product grew 20% week-over-week in late 2019 and saw 110% monthly visit growth between March and April 2020. By 2020, Roam raised a $9M seed at a $200M valuation — extraordinary for a note-taking tool.\n\n**The aha moment:** Bidirectional links. Every note you write automatically links back to every other note that mentions the same concept. Nat Eliason, whose review ([nateliason.com](https://www.nateliason.com/blog/roam)) seeded much of Roam's early growth, described the experience as \"creating links between articles, people, places, and ideas keeps growing and spitting out new relationships I hadn't thought of or had forgotten about.\" Users describe the aha as occurring when they visit a note they wrote months earlier and find it connected, without manual effort, to ten subsequent notes that recontextualize it. The second brain metaphor became literal: the tool appeared to remember connections the user had forgotten they made.\n\n**Why it worked as a single-player tool:** Roam was useful on day one, for one person, for any knowledge-intensive activity. No network effect was required. The community (the #RoamCult Twitter phenomenon) emerged organically from early adopters sharing templates, workflows, and evangelism — but the product didn't need the community to work. The community formed because individuals had transformative personal experiences worth sharing.\n\n**The social bridge:** Templates. Roam users published workflow templates that other users imported. This created a lightweight social layer that required no direct interaction — consuming someone's template felt communal without requiring synchronous engagement.\n\n**Limitation that opened the door to competitors:** Roam's founder prioritized product philosophy over reliability. Significant downtime and no mobile app allowed Obsidian to capture the pragmatic segment.\n\n---\n\n### 1.2 Obsidian: Local-First as a Political Statement\n\nObsidian launched in 2020 as a direct response to Roam — local-first, free for personal use, built on plain Markdown files. As of February 2026, Obsidian has 1.5 million users with 22% year-over-year growth ([fueler.io](https://fueler.io/blog/obsidian-usage-revenue-valuation-growth-statistics)). The company is bootstrapped, 18 people, no venture funding.\n\n**The aha moment:** Opening a vault of Markdown files and seeing the graph view for the first time — a network of connected nodes representing one's own thinking. Unlike Roam's web-based approach, Obsidian's local storage meant notes would exist and remain accessible indefinitely, independent of any company's continued existence.\n\n**Why it worked as a single-player tool:** The value proposition was entirely about personal intellectual infrastructure. \"Your notes as plain Markdown files on your device\" ([Obsidian](https://obsidian.md/)) is a security claim, not a social claim. Users who felt burned by web-based tools closing (Evernote's decline, Workflowy's limited development) found psychological safety in local storage. The plugin ecosystem — 2,700+ community-developed plugins as of 2026 — extended functionality without expanding the company.\n\n**The personal→social bridge:** Obsidian Publish turns a private vault into a public website. \"Digital gardens\" — shared, evolving personal knowledge bases — emerged as a cultural format around Obsidian. These are not collaborative documents; they are one person's thinking made visible for others to explore. The social experience is asymmetric: one person curates, many people browse. This is lower friction than collaborative editing but generates genuine community: readers discuss posts in external forums, link to each other's gardens, and form an informal intellectual network ([obsidian.rocks](https://obsidian.rocks/sharing-notes-with-obsidian/)).\n\n**Key lesson:** Local-first is not a technical choice — it is a trust signal. Users who are skeptical of cloud lock-in are disproportionately willing to pay for a product that matches their values. For Deliberus, this suggests that user data ownership (your argument graphs belong to you, portable, exportable) could function as a positioning signal that attracts the exact users — rationalists, researchers, privacy-aware professionals — who are the natural early adopters.\n\n---\n\n### 1.3 Logseq: Open Source Radical Transparency\n\nLogseq positioned itself as the open-source alternative to Roam, with Obsidian-like local storage plus a daily note system. It has attracted users from Google Brain, IDEO, Meta, Tesla, MIT, Stanford, and Harvard ([VentureBeat](https://venturebeat.com/business/meet-logseq-an-open-source-knowledge-management-system-that-stores-data-like-a-brain)).\n\n**The aha moment:** The combination of block-based outlining with bidirectional links — the same structural approach as Roam, but open source and locally stored. For users in academic or research settings, the ability to inspect and modify the underlying code mattered.\n\n**Why it worked as single-player:** Same as Obsidian — the personal value proposition required no network. However, Logseq added a wrinkle: because it is open source, the community itself could build features. Within three months of launch, the community had created over 80 plugins ([VentureBeat](https://venturebeat.com/business/meet-logseq-an-open-source-knowledge-management-system-that-stores-data-like-a-brain)). This created a positive feedback loop where individual contributions enhanced the single-player experience for all users.\n\n**Key lesson:** Open-source community contributions function as distributed single-player feature development. Each contributor is solving their own problem; the aggregate result benefits all users.\n\n---\n\n### 1.4 Notion: The Template Economy as Distribution\n\nNotion grew from 1 million to 4 million active users between 2019 and 2020, reaching $10M ARR in 2020 ([ShorterLoop](https://www.shorterloop.com/the-product-mindset/posts/notions-success-story-decoded-the-product-led-growth-journey)). Its trajectory is the clearest model of personal→team→enterprise expansion in knowledge software.\n\n**The aha moment:** The moment when a user realizes they can replace five separate tools (notes, tasks, wiki, database, calendar) with one flexible workspace. Notion's blocks system made this feel like infinite customization without coding.\n\n**Why it worked as single-player:** Notion's free tier was deliberately generous for individual use. Templates served as the discovery mechanism — \"people discovered Notion through the template, not through the homepage\" ([First Round Review](https://review.firstround.com/how-notion-does-marketing-a-deep-dive-into-its-community-influencers-growth-playbooks/)). Each template was a self-contained single-player use case (habit tracker, reading list, project tracker) that happened to live in a platform with collaboration features.\n\n**The personal→social bridge:** Notion's viral loop was explicit: the very first action new users were prompted to take was to invite teammates. The product's value increased exponentially with each additional collaborator. Crucially, this worked because the personal value was already established — users weren't inviting teammates to see something empty; they were sharing a workspace they had already built for themselves.\n\n**Key lesson:** The template is a Trojan horse. A single-player artifact (my reading list, my project tracker) becomes a social invitation when shared. For Deliberus, a user's argument map on a topic is both a personal thinking tool and a potential social artifact — something that can be shared with \"hey, I mapped out this argument, what do you think?\"\n\n---\n\n### 1.5 Workflowy: Simplicity as the Feature\n\nWorkflowy launched in 2010 and grew to over 2 million users at profitability ([outlinersoftware.com](https://www.outlinersoftware.com/topics/viewt/5600/0/workflowy-use)). Stewart Butterfield, CEO of Slack, was a public fan.\n\n**The aha moment:** A single infinitely nested list that can focus on any node, collapsing everything else. The UI has essentially one feature, which means there is no friction between the user and organizing their thoughts.\n\n**Why it worked as single-player:** \"The magic of Workflowy is that it's so simple that you get to design how to use it based on how you think and work\" ([Duct Tape Marketing](https://ducttapemarketing.com/workflowy-to-keep-organized/)). This is a crucial insight: tools that match the user's existing mental model, rather than imposing a new one, have dramatically lower adoption friction. Users described Workflowy as \"delightful interaction\" and praised the \"no-effort\" quality of the UI.\n\n**Key lesson:** Single-player adoption requires matching the user's existing behavior, not teaching them a new one. Workflowy succeeded because outlining was already how many people thought — they just needed a better tool for it. Deliberus faces the challenge that structured argumentation is *not* how most people currently think. The entry point must match existing behavior (taking notes, making decisions, reading articles) and reveal the structure afterward, rather than demanding structure upfront.\n\n---\n\n### 1.6 Miro / FigJam: Visual Thinking's Team Problem\n\nMiro and FigJam are instructive as counterexamples. For Deliberus, this means the single-player experience must be the primary design target, with collaborative features layered on top — not the reverse.\n\n---\n\n### Summary Table: Single-Player Aha Moments\n\n| Tool | Single-Player Aha | Network Effect Layer |\n|------|------------------|---------------------|\n| Roam Research | Backlinks reveal connections you forgot you made | Template sharing, #RoamCult |\n| Obsidian | Your thinking, locally stored, forever | Digital gardens, plugin ecosystem |\n| Logseq | Open-source PKM with community-built features | Plugin contributors solve everyone's problems |\n| Notion | One tool replaces five; templates match your use case | Invite collaborators; template discovery |\n| Workflowy | Infinite nesting + focus = frictionless outlining | Shared lists, team accounts |\n| Miro/FigJam | Minimal (designed for teams, single-player is weak) | Synchronous collaboration |\n\n---\n\n## 2. \"Paste URL → Get Argument Map\" as Entry Point\n\n### 2.1 What Currently Exists\n\nThe \"paste URL → get insight\" category is already established. Readwise Reader allows users to save articles, highlight key passages, and generate AI summaries through its Ghostreader feature — a \"document-aware research assistant\" that can explain passages, generate flashcards from highlights, and provide document summaries ([Readwise](https://readwise.io/read)). Users report saving 2-3 hours weekly on research tasks and 40% better recall of key information.\n\nRedditTLDR and Threadly represent the Reddit-specific variant — tools that accept a Reddit URL and return a structured summary of the discussion. These tools use NLP to identify key points and sentiment without any user-imposed structure.\n\nAI argument map generators (e.g., ChatDiagram's argument map generator, draw.io's Smart Template integration) can take a passage of text and produce a visual argument map. These exist but have not achieved significant adoption, likely because the output — a generic map — is not coupled to any particular use case that would drive return visits.\n\n### 2.2 The Gap: Structure Without Purpose\n\nThe current tools produce either (a) summaries (useful, but structureless) or (b) argument maps (structured, but not anchored to a user's actual decision). Personal Argument Analysis Use Cases\n\nThe following use cases all deliver value to a single user with zero community involvement. Each represents a distinct user persona with a distinct relationship to structured argumentation.\n\n### 3.1 Decision-Making (Pros/Cons with Depth)\n\nThe simple pros/cons list is one of the most widely used personal thinking tools in existence — and one of the most cognitively limited. Pros/cons lists:\n- Treat all considerations as equal weight\n- Do not reveal which considerations depend on which empirical claims\n- Do not surface the *reasons* behind the pros (why is \"work-life balance\" a pro? what evidence does the user have for it?)\n- Do not expose hidden assumptions\n\nAn LLM-powered argument analysis tool for personal decisions could replace the pros/cons list with a richer structure that reveals the logical dependencies between considerations. \"I should take this job\" is supported by \"the salary is higher,\" which is supported by \"$X vs $Y\" (empirical, verifiable), and \"higher salary matters to me,\" which is supported by \"I have debt,\" which is verifiable, and \"financial security reduces anxiety for me,\" which is personal and not up for debate. Revealing this dependency structure helps the user see *which* considerations are load-bearing and *which* depend on assumptions they should question.\n\nRationale AI ([rationale.jina.ai](https://rationale.jina.ai/)) is the closest existing tool — a \"revolutionary decision-making AI powered by the latest GPT\" that generates pros/cons analyses with structured reasoning. It exists as a direct competitor in this space, though it does not produce argument maps in the formal sense.\n\n### 3.2 Research Synthesis (Academic Paper Argumentation Extraction)\n\nAcademic papers have a formal argumentative structure: a claim (the thesis), premises (the evidence), a methodology (the link between evidence and claim), and limitations (concessions). The Personal→Social Bridge\n\n### 4.1 The \"Come for the Tool, Stay for the Network\" Pattern\n\nChris Dixon's 2010 essay on single-player and multiplayer product modes ([cdixon.org](https://cdixon.org/2010/06/12/designing-products-for-single-and-multiplayer-modes/)) articulated the canonical framework: tools that deliver immediate single-player value and gradually introduce network features are more defensible than pure networks that require community to function. Instagram's photo filters (single-player) enabled its photo-sharing network (multiplayer). Figma's design tools (usable solo) enabled its collaborative design platform.\n\nThis pattern has been validated repeatedly since Dixon's framing. The strategic formulation is: \"come for the tool, stay for the network effects\" ([ReadTheHypothesis](https://www.readthehypothesis.com/p/network-effects-single-player-mode-hook)).\n\n### 4.2 How PKM Tools Bridge to Social\n\n**Obsidian Publish / Digital Gardens:** The most successful social bridge in the PKM space is not collaborative editing — it is *public thinking*. Existing Personal Argument Tools: Landscape Analysis\n\n### 5.1 Argdown: For the Developer Who Thinks in Arguments\n\nArgdown ([argdown.org](https://argdown.org/)) is a lightweight markup language for argument mapping — \"like Markdown for arguments.\" Users write in plain text with a syntax that can be learned in three minutes; the tool renders argument maps in real time. A VS Code extension integrates it into existing development workflows. An Obsidian plugin brings it into the PKM ecosystem.\n\n**Who uses it:** Developers, academics, and technical writers who are comfortable with markup languages and prefer text-first workflows. The Argdown-Obsidian integration suggests users who already use Obsidian as their primary thinking environment.\n\n**What it proves:** There is a real audience for text-based argument formalization — but it is small (developer-adjacent, technical) and does not generalize to the broad knowledge worker audience that Deliberus targets. Argdown is \"Markdown for arguments\" in the way that LaTeX is \"Markdown for academic papers\" — powerful, beloved by its niche, too high-friction for mainstream adoption.\n\n**What Deliberus should learn from it:** The Obsidian integration is interesting. Users who already have a PKM practice are more likely to be interested in argument mapping than users with no such practice. Integrating with Obsidian as an export/import target (export an Obsidian note as a Deliberus argument map; import a Deliberus map into an Obsidian vault) could be a distribution mechanism.\n\n### 5.2 Rationale: The Argument Mapping Specialist\n\nTim van Gelder's Rationale ([reasoninglab.com](https://www.reasoninglab.com/learn/)) is a dedicated single-user argument mapping tool. Van Gelder's research demonstrated that instruction in argument mapping using Rationale produced 0.7-0.85 standard deviation gains in critical thinking ability in first-year philosophy students. This is a significant measured effect.\n\n**Why it stayed niche:** Rationale is a desktop application designed for formal academic argument mapping. Its interface is optimized for someone who already knows what argument mapping is and wants to do it correctly. There is no LLM integration, no URL-to-map entry point, and no social layer. It is a precision tool for users who already know they need it.\n\n**What it proves:** Argument mapping software delivers real cognitive benefits when used correctly. The limitation is not efficacy — it is discoverability and adoption friction. Users must already understand argument mapping to get value from Rationale. Deliberus needs to make the value visible before the user understands the method.\n\n### 5.3 Symbai: The AI Debate Coach\n\nSymbai ([symbai.ai](https://symbai.ai/)) is the most interesting recent entrant — a platform that combines AI-powered debate coaching with visual argument mapping. Individual debaters use it for solo practice: map your argument on a canvas, then debate an AI opponent in structured rounds with coaching feedback.\n\n**What makes it work as single-player:** The AI opponent solves the cold-start problem. The user does not need another human. The AI provides the counter-arguments, the pressure-testing, and the coaching. This is genuine single-player utility for the debate preparation use case.\n\n**Deliberus's differentiation from Symbai:** Symbai is optimized for competitive debate format (timed rounds, formal structure, scoring). Deliberus's scope is broader: any knowledge worker reasoning about any topic, not just competitive debaters. Additionally, Symbai does not address the evidence layer — claims in Deliberus should be linked to their supporting evidence, not just stated.\n\n### 5.4 Debate Map: Open Source, Public Arguments\n\nDebate Map ([debatemap.app](https://debatemap.app/)) is an open-source tool for mapping beliefs, arguments, and evidence. It is public by default — maps are shared and browsable. Users can build on each other's argument trees.\n\n**What makes it interesting:** It is the closest existing approximation to what Deliberus might become socially. Arguments are structured as trees with explicit support/attack relationships. Evidence is linked. Maps are public and collaborative.\n\n**Why it has not reached mainstream adoption:** Debate Map suffers from the same cold-start problem as Kialo — it is designed for collaborative use and delivers weak single-player value. Without a community, a new user faces an empty or unfamiliar map. The tool also lacks LLM integration for automatic claim extraction, meaning users must do the formalization work manually.\n\n### 5.5 AI Argument Generators: The Low-Quality Flood\n\nA proliferation of AI argument generators has emerged (ChatDiagram, YesChat, HyperWrite, Junia, Typli) that take a topic or text and produce an argument map or debate content. These are essentially wrapper products over ChatGPT or similar models.\n\n**Why they have not found sustained adoption:** The output is generic, unanchored to the user's actual decision, and non-persistent. There is no concept of a knowledge base — each generation is stateless. Users who find these tools useful are not accumulating anything of value across sessions.\n\n**What they prove:** There is demand for AI-powered argument assistance. The demand is real enough that multiple products have emerged to serve it. The gap is in depth, persistence, and context-sensitivity — the things that would make a user return.\n\n---\n\n## 6.
